Output 901d8a4860ae42dda728c7e551806fe7566fbd8b13d455be5718530005679a94:129

value
666000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ac23255b3a12e6dea97f8c83a3c68832bd9f40d OP_EQUAL
address
3HFuSAy2r5BzPZN3VzhfCHdmDxSy2bz3rs
transaction
901d8a4860ae42dda728c7e551806fe7566fbd8b13d455be5718530005679a94
confirmations
76794
spent
true